The comment2tex package (v1.0)
I am pleased to announce the first release of comment2tex.
comment2tex typesets a source file that keeps its documentation
in special comments: doc-comment lines become ordinary LaTeX,
everything else becomes a listing.
A Lua converter handles the transformation and two TeX wrappers,
one for LaTeX/LuaLaTeX and one for plain TeX, provide \includebash
and \includelua to pull annotated Bash or Lua sources into a document.
Under LuaLaTeX the conversion runs in process;
under pdfLaTeX it uses shell escape or a separate pre-build run.

## A new package `docext` is published on CTAN.
The `docext` package is an extension for documenting the LaTeX source files. It
is based on the `doc` package and works smoothly under the `l3doc`, `ltxdoc`,
and~`article` classes.

The package lets you inspect, from anywhere in the document body,
the files LaTeX has used in the current document:
â–ª \printfilelist lists them with version information (optionally
filtered, or as a compact inline list), and
â–ª \ispackageloaded reports whether a given package is loaded.
It requires nothing beyond the LaTeX kernel.

autoaffil is a new LaTeX package that provides the author/affiliation layout
style common in physics and related fields: all authors appear in a single block
with superscript numbers linking each name to a list of affiliations printed
below — the style native to revtex4-2 with the superscriptaddress option, and
familiar from journals such as Physical Review Letters.
The package brings this style to the standard article class and compatible
classes. Authors and affiliations are declared individually in the preamble;
identical affiliation strings are automatically deduplicated and numbered in
order of first appearance; \maketitle outputs the complete block.
Package options: ranges (compress 3+ consecutive numbers to n--m),
superaftercomma (revtex4-2-style comma placement), nobreak (prevent line breaks
within name+superscript units), and manual (suppress auto-insertion for full
placement control). The only dependency is etoolbox.
